Energy Efficiency (EE) has always been “cost effective”. Renewable Energy (RE) is now “cost effective”. So why haven’t these really taken off? Beyond the technical components, the seminar attempts to examine the attitude changes required to truly support amplifying EE and RE efforts. Doing so brings society a step closer to devising successful solutions to address the climate challenge and the existential threat - and opportunity - it presents.
Participants will be challenged to imagine opportunities for approaching the climate challenge through solid economics. A wide range of foundational topics will be discussed, including:
- Policy Development for ensuring success
- Site Energy Master Planning - goal setting, prioritization
- Economics for energy efficiency and renewable energy
- Community scale opportunities
- Funding sources
- and more.
